How much does it cost to rent a home in Lake Bryan Shoppes?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Lake Bryan Shoppes 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,026 | $979 | $3,000 |
| Lake Bryan Shoppes 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,454 | $1,700 | $6,500 |
| Lake Bryan Shoppes 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,854 | $2,000 | $5,250 |
| Lake Bryan Shoppes 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,084 | $2,800 | $7,400 |
| Lake Bryan Shoppes 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,296 | $4,000 | $6,900 |
| Lake Bryan Shoppes 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,990 | $5,990 | $5,990 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Lake Bryan Shoppes
What type of rentals are currently available in Lake Bryan Shoppes?
There are currently 82 Apartments for Rent in Lake Bryan Shoppes, FL with pricing that ranges from $1,150 to $9,427. There are also 192 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Lake Bryan Shoppes ranging from $825 to $7,400.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Lake Bryan Shoppes?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Lake Bryan Shoppes ranges from $825 to $7,400 with an average monthly rent of $3,637.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Lake Bryan Shoppes?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Lake Bryan Shoppes range from $1,795 to $4,815,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,700 to $6,500.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,000 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,388.
